Output 84a2716925afe577a78f69d4c13963870e3262989427d178da6c92020d90280f:5

value
19866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 03cacc3680e7dd7f8ca80cc1c85a1a56e600d2d3a0d9efbc304ddf6514568180
address
bc1pq09vcd5qulwhlr9gpnqusks62mnqp5kn5rv7l0psfh0k29zksxqq2shqu2
transaction
84a2716925afe577a78f69d4c13963870e3262989427d178da6c92020d90280f
spent
true